DALLAS, Oct. 24, 2016 -- Triumph Bancorp, Inc. (NASDAQ:TBK) today announced the addition of Fred Perpall to its board of directors. Perpall serves as the chief executive officer for The Beck Group, an architecture and construction company based in Dallas, Texas. He has served in this role since 2013, and has been with Beck since 1999.
“Fred brings a wealth of knowledge and experience to our board of directors,” Carlos M. Sepulveda, Jr., chairman of the board for Triumph Bancorp, Inc., said. “In addition to his business acumen, Fred has an incredibly creative mind and innovative way of thinking that is going to bring immense value to Triumph. We are looking forward to the impact he will have in this position.”
Perpall serves on numerous boards and executive committees, including the Dallas Regional Chamber, the Dallas Citizens Council and The Carter Center. He is a native of Nassau, Bahamas, and earned his Bachelor of Science and Master of Architecture degrees from the University of Texas at Arlington.
